WebMultiply the width by the length by the depth to find the number of cubic feet of soil you need. For example, if the length is 10 feet, the width is 10 feet, and the depth is 0.25 feet, the result is 25 cubic feet (10 x 10 x 0.25 = … Web29 sep. 2024 · A cubic foot of dirt mixed with topsoil can weigh about 80 pounds or 0.04 short tons, in general, it can be range between 74 110 pounds per cubic foot, dry loose dirt can weigh around 76 lbs per cubic foot, and while moist loose dirt can weight around 78 lbs per cubic foot. For example, you can enter measurements of length in inches … Web11 feb. 2024 · One cubic yard of dry topsoil averages around 1,080 pounds. When wet that number can increase to up to a ton or 2,000 pounds. How much topsoil is in a scoop? A scoop of topsoil is usually equivalent to a front loader bucket full or around 1/2 cubic yard.
